Synopsis
Queen Elizabeth II is dead. After a lifetime of waiting, her son ascends the throne.
A future of power. But how to rule?
Drawing on the style and structure of Shakespeare, Mike Bartlett's controversial 'future history play' explores the people beneath the crowns, the unwritten rules of our democracy, and the conscience of Britain's most famous family.
